Cru Wines
Ried ECKBERG Weissburgunder 2023
The Eckberg vineyard is a steep, east-facing slope situated at 400 to 450 meters above sea level. In the early morning hours, its easterly exposure allows the vines to soak up the first rays of sunlight. The marl soil, rich in nutrients, works in harmony with the sun to impart remarkable vitality to the vines. Pinot Blanc has a long tradition in Südsteiermark and the Eckberg shows charming and food-friendly with delicate fruit and silken body.

Premier Cru Wines
Ried STEINBACH Sauvignon Blanc 2022
Rising between 400 and 470 meters above sea level, the oldest vineyards around our estate unfold along steep, sun-kissed slopes facing south to southwest. Wines from Steinbach are distinguished by their elegance and precision. Marked by finely chiseled fruit, delicate minerality, and a lively, balanced structure.

Grand Cru Wines
RIED WELLES SAUVIGNON BLANC 2021
The unmistakable character of this particular site is marked by the gravel conglomerate on which Sauvignon Blanc vines of exceptional quality thrive: On the nose, pronounced aromas of ripe dark currant, guava, white dried tea leaves and dark minerality. The body is dense and punchy, in conjunction with a finesse-rich acidity and saline tension. Complex flavors continued on the palate,
opening up with increasing oxygen contact. A wine with an aging potential of 10 years and more.

RIED FLAMBERG Morillon 2022
This mineral and finely chiselled wine is the result of the limestone soil and cool microclimate of the Flamberg vineyard. It’s a delightful expression of freshness and finesse, with vibrant notes of Amalfi lemon and a bouquet of garden herbs. Its delicate, silky texture is paired with a medium-bodied frame, making it both refreshing and elegant. The finish is impressively long with incredible
minerality and precision. Made from organically grown grapes, this wine offers a pure, refined experience from start to finish.
